Karl Moore on taking an extrovert break

Published: 5 June 2017

Karl Moore can talk to anyone, writes prolifically, and lends his expertise on a wide range of subjects. But in a recent piece for Forbes, the Desautels Professor admits that one thing he can鈥檛 do is work from home.

He blames it on the fact that he is an extrovert: after a few hours spent banging out a book, Prof. Moore needs human contact in order to recharge his batteries.

He calls it taking an 鈥渆xtrovert break,鈥 and it鈥檚 exactly the opposite of the alone time that an introverted manager often needs in order to remain effective.
